Police Clearance Certificate or Good Conduct Certificate is also commonly known as a Police Clearance Report. The Police Clearance Report for foreigners confirms whether you have a criminal record or not. Police Clearance Certificate is a document that is issued by the Office of the Commissioner of Police, Tuvalu Police Force, in Tuvalu, certifying that the applicant has never partaken in any criminal activity that led to the involvement of the Tuvalu Police Authorities, and is also required when a person applies for an immigration status to other countries. Person applying for Police Clearance Certificate (PCC) are required to state the period of stay in Tuvalu. It is issued to any individual who reside more than 6 months in Tuvalu.
You need to provide a filled prescribed completed application form for a Police Clearance Report. The completed form can be submitted at the the Commissioner of Police, Tuvalu Police Force. Full set of fingerprints of both the hands obtained from the applicant’s at our lab on prescribed fingerprint form, certified by our official stamp of our organization. The completed application form with other supporting documents are directly forwarded to Tuvalu Police Force, in Tuvalu .The the Commissioner of Police, Tuvalu Police Force takes around 4 to 5 weeks under to process the application if no criminal record found and after that they send the certified Police Clearance Report via regular mail.
